When U-Boot started using SPDX tags we were among the early adopters and
there weren't a lot of other examples to borrow from.  So we picked the
area of the file that usually had a full license text and replaced it
with an appropriate SPDX-License-Identifier: entry.  Since then, the
Linux Kernel has adopted SPDX tags and they place it as the very first
line in a file (except where shebangs are used, then it's second line)
and with slightly different comment styles than us.

In part due to community overlap, in part due to better tag visibility
and in part for other minor reasons, switch over to that style.

This commit changes all instances where we have a single declared
license in the tag as both the before and after are identical in tag
contents.  There's also a few places where I found we did not have a tag
and have introduced one.

#include <common.h>
#include <asm/fsl_law.h>
#include <asm/mmu.h>
/*
* LAW(Local Access Window) configuration:
*
*0) 0x0000_0000 0x7fff_ffff DDR 2G
*1) 0xa000_0000 0xbfff_ffff PCIe MEM 512MB
*-) 0xe000_0000 0xe00f_ffff CCSR 1M
*2) 0xe280_0000 0xe2ff_ffff PCIe I/O 8M
*3) 0xc000_0000 0xdfff_ffff SRIO 512MB
*4.a) 0xf000_0000 0xf3ff_ffff SDRAM 64MB
*4.b) 0xf800_0000 0xf800_7fff BCSR 32KB
*4.c) 0xf800_8000 0xf800_ffff PIB (CS4) 32KB
*4.d) 0xf801_0000 0xf801_7fff PIB (CS5) 32KB
*4.e) 0xfe00_0000 0xffff_ffff Flash 32MB
*
*Notes:
* CCSRBAR and L2-as-SRAM don't need a configured Local Access Window.
* If flash is 8M at default position (last 8M), no LAW needed.
*
*/
struct law_entry law_table[] = {
#ifndef CONFIG_SPD_EEPROM
SET_LAW(CONFIG_SYS_DDR_SDRAM_BASE, LAW_SIZE_1G, LAW_TRGT_IF_DDR),
#endif
SET_LAW(CONFIG_SYS_BCSR_BASE_PHYS, LAW_SIZE_128M, LAW_TRGT_IF_LBC),
};
int num_law_entries = ARRAY_SIZE(law_table);
